
The eighth season of Shetland is poised to make its grand return to BBC One, and the anticipation is palpable. This season is sparking quite the buzz, as Ashley Jensen steps into the spotlight as the new lead. The acclaimed Scottish actress fills the void left by Douglas Henshall, taking on the role of Met Police detective Ruth Calder. She finds herself back in her beloved Shetland, delving deep into a riveting murder investigation.

Shetland Season 8 Synopsis
The eighth season of Shetland on BBC teases a captivating narrative twist. DI Ruth Calder is drawn back to her roots in Shetland, on a mission to secure a vulnerable witness tied to a menacing gangland homicide.
Simultaneously, DS Alison ‘Tosh’ McIntosh faces a pressing detour. She momentarily pauses her probe into a string of mysterious animal fatalities to rally behind DI Calder. The race is on to locate the witness before time runs out.
Shetland Season 8 Cast
Shetland season 8 boasts an ensemble cast that’s sure to captivate. Alison O’Donnell joins forces with Ashley, once again donning the role of DS Tosh. Loyal viewers will be pleased to see familiar faces like Steven Robertson as DC Sandy Wilson, Lewis Howden as Sgt Billy McCabe, Angus Miller as Donnie, Anne Kidd as Cora McLean, Conor McCarry as PC Alex Grant, and Eubha Akilade as PC Lorna Burns.
But the intrigue doesn’t stop there! New talents are joining the Shetland roster, such as Annika’s Jamie Sives, Downton Abbey’s very own Phyllis Logan, Granite Harbour’s Dawn Steele, and the charismatic Don Gilet from Sherwood.
When does Shetland Season 8 premiere?
Shetland Season 8 will peremiere on November 1, 2023 on BBC One and iPlayer.
